Dive into an extraordinary sensory journey inside the Sphere in Las Vegas, where vibrant, surreal botanical imagery blankets the interior in a kaleidoscope of colors and shapes. This breathtaking display captivates the senses, evoking wonder and awe as delicate flowers bloom in brilliant purples, reds, and oranges, accompanied by giant mystical shapes and cascading waterfalls. The electric energy of the enthusiastic crowd amplifies the immersive magic, crafting a mesmerizing experience for every travel enthusiast seeking cutting-edge entertainment and artistic brilliance in the heart of Nevada's entertainment capital.

The nearest airport is McCarran International Airport (LAS), about a 15-minute drive from the Sphere venue in Las Vegas.
